Ingredients you’ll need

  • Frozen Waffle Fries
  • Half and Half
  • Cream Cheese
  • Butter
  • Salt
  • Cumin
  • Garlic Powder
  • Diced Green Chilies
  • Cabot Seriously Sharp & Extra Sharp Cheddar Cheese

Optional toppings

The great thing about nachos is making them your own by adding any or all of your favorite toppings! Here’s a few things to try.

  • Diced Tomatoes
  • Sliced Jalapenos
  • Fresh Chopped Cilantro
  • Diced Avocado

How to make them

  1. Cook the waffle fries.
    • Preheat the oven to 450°F.
    • Arrange the waffle fries in an even layer on a parchment-lined rimmed baking sheet.
    • Place the fries in the oven and cook for 20 minutes.
  2. Prepare the green chili cheese sauce.
    • Add half and half, cream cheese, butter, salt, cumin and garlic powder to a medium pot on the stove over medium heat.
    • Stir consistently until the mixture is smooth and creamy.
    • Add the diced green chilis and stir to combine.
    • Reduce the heat on the stove to low, add shredded Cabot cheddar cheese and stir constantly until the cheese has melted into the sauce.
  3. Assemble the nachos.
    • As soon as the waffle fries come out of the oven, pour the green chili cheese sauce over the fries.
    • Add the toppings of your choice and dig in!

Pro tips

  • This recipe makes enough nachos to serve 4-6 people. Since we’re a family of 2 at my house, we make the green chili cheese sauce, but only cook half of the waffle fries for one meal and then cook the remaining waffle fries for another meal. The cheese sauce will stay good in the refrigerator for up to 5 days and reheats easily in a pot on the stove over medium heat.
  • The cheese sauce is good for more than just nachos! I promise that you’re going to fall in love with this epic cheese sauce and want to put it on everything… and I fully support that!
    • Use it as a dip! Dip your favorite chips or veggies straight into the cheese sauce.
    • Make traditional nachos. No waffle fries in your freezer? No problem! Pour this delectable sauce over tortilla chips to make traditional nachos.
    • Smother a burrito. Prepare a chicken, veggie or carne asada burrito and cover it in this green chili cheese sauce. We did this with breakfast burritos in our house and I can tell you that it was truly epic!
  • Do not overcrowd the baking sheet of waffle fries. You want the fries in an even layer so they get nice and crispy, which might mean using two baking sheets. Not to worry, you can always combine the fries back onto one baking sheet after they’ve cooked in the oven and top them with the cheese sauce.
